Daily Bible Affirmation for February 01, 2025 – Hebrews 11:1
Bible Verse
“Now faith is confidence in what we hope for and assurance about what we do not see.” – Hebrews 11:1 (NIV)
Reflection
Faith—this powerful, yet often abstract, concept serves as a foundation for our daily lives as believers. Hebrews 11:1 encapsulates the essence of faith by defining it as both confidence and assurance. It urges us to look beyond our present circumstances and place our trust in the promises of God, even when the evidence of their fulfillment is not immediately visible.
In a world that often prioritizes tangible results and immediate gratification, embracing the idea of hope in things unseen can be quite challenging. We may find ourselves caught in the cycle of doubt, questioning the very essence of our faith. What does it mean to hope for something we cannot see? This verse invites us to embrace a deeper understanding of faith, urging us to develop an unshakeable belief in God’s goodness and faithfulness.
To lean into faith means confronting our fears and uncertainties with a heart anchored in the knowledge of who God is. It is a call to remember that faith is not merely a passive wish; rather, it is an active choice to trust in the character of God. As we reflect on this verse, we see that faith is dual-edged—it combines our hopes for the future with a steadfast assurance that God is at work even when we do not see it.
